前言
作为前端开发人员,我们经常需要使用各种 npm 包来解决实际问题,其中 swint-fork 是一个实用的工具,可以帮助我们在多个项目中管理代码。
swint-fork 的主要功能是自动化管理和跨项目复用代码,它可以方便地把一个项目中的代码集成到其他项目中,做到代码的复用和自动更新。
本文将介绍 swint-fork 的详细使用方法,包括安装、配置以及如何在项目中使用它。希望本文能够帮助到正在寻找类似工具的前端开发人员。
安装
swint-fork 可以通过 npm 包管理器来安装,我们只需要在项目中运行以下命令即可:
npm install swint-fork --save-dev
在安装完成后,我们可以在项目中使用 require('swint-fork')
来调用 swint-fork 模块。
配置
在开始使用 swint-fork 前,我们需要在项目中配置一些信息,比如要集成的项目路径和要复制的文件等。
我们可以在项目根目录下创建一个名为 swint.json
的配置文件,并按照以下格式填写:
-- -------------------- ---- ------- - --------- - ------- ------------------- -------- - ----------- ------------- - -- -------- - - ------- ----------- ------- ------------------- -- - ------- ----------- ------- ------------------- - - -
在上面的配置文件中,"origin" 表示要集成的项目信息,包括项目路径和要复制的文件。"forks" 表示要将代码集成到的项目列表,包括项目名称和路径信息。
使用
配置完成后,我们就可以在项目中使用 swint-fork 工具了。我们可以使用以下命令将代码集成到指定的项目中:
swint-fork [fork_name]
其中,"[fork_name]" 表示要集成到的项目名称。例如,我们可以使用以下命令将代码集成到名为 "project1" 的项目中:
swint-fork project1
swint-fork 工具会在 "project1" 项目的指定路径中复制 "origin" 中的文件,并在未来的修改中自动更新这些文件。
示例代码
下面是一个使用 swint-fork 工具的示例代码:
const swintFork = require('swint-fork'); swintFork('project1');
结论
以上就是使用 swint-fork 工具的详细介绍,通过使用 swint-fork 工具,我们可以方便地管理和复用代码,减少重复工作量。
希望本文能够帮助到正在寻找类似工具的前端开发人员。如果您有任何疑问或者建议,欢迎在评论区留言。
来源:JavaScript中文网 ,转载请注明来源 https://www.javascriptcn.com/post/73207